Peony pest control technology

aphid

Aphids are very fertile and can breed for many generations a year. A large number of locusts often gather on kale leaves and tender stalks to suck juice.

Control methods When the locust starts, it can spray 40% omethoate, dimethoate 1000-1500 times solution or phoxim emulsion 1000-1500 times solution.

The leaf roller moth, commonly known as leaf leafworm, is harmed by its larvae leaf curls, and often the leaf is rolled up with silk and hidden in it for feeding hazards.

Prevention and control method 1. In the winter, the dry grass and leaves around the planting site should be cleaned and burned to eliminate the overwintering parasites. 2. When the galls with leafy moth are found, the larvae in the leaf should be removed or directly crushed; 3. When it happens, it can spray 50% killer pine or 80% of dichlorvos or 50% of zinc-phosphorus 1000-1500 times. Naphthalene WP can also be sprayed 1000-2000 times.

cabbage caterpillar

The adults of Pieris rapae are active during the day, the eggs are produced on the back of the leaves, and the larval populations feed on the leaves. After 3 years of age, the harm was dispersed and sooner or later it was taken from the leaves, leaves or tender shoots, and the injured leaves were indented.

Control methods can catch larvae manually. When there are a large number of larvae, 80% of dichlorvos EC or 1000-1500 times of locust pine should be sprayed in time. Spraying with 40% omethoate 1500-2000 times also has some effect.

Soft rot

In the early stage of soft rot, 70% thiophanate-methyl wettable powder can be used to water 600 times, or 70% mancozeb WP can be sprayed with 500 times water.

Downy mildew

In the early stage of the onset of downy mildew, 50% Suo Ke Ling WP can be diluted 1000-1200 times, or 58% Metalaxyl Manganese Zinc WP can be sprayed with 500 times water.
